Secure Rural Schools

Secure Rural Schools and Community Self-Determination Act of 2000, also known informally as county payments, might sound wonky, but it is actually an incredibly important resource for our National Forest neighbors.  This piece of legislation, threatened with elimination last year, brings millions of dollars into our communities in the North Cascades and supports schools, search and rescue and vital National Forest restoration programs. The Wilderness Society joined with county leaders from Okanogan and Chelan counties and successfully gained passage of a bill renewing county payments for four years.  The bill puts more than $2 million in revenue into the counties at a time when they are hard hit by the recession.  This is an example of how the North Cascades Initiative works through collaboration with local leaders.

Restoration and Wildfire
Chumstick Wildfire Stewardship Coalition logoWildfire is a hot button issue in the North Cascades and one community near Leavenworth is working to educate landowners about wildfire and restore the adjacent National Forest. We bring our science and policy expertise to the Chumstick Wildfire Stewardship Coalition to help them lessen the risk of wildfire and restore the watershed.  The collation is a group of local landowners, residents, public officials and conservation organizations.

The New Resource Economy
Conservation, restoration, recreation and tourism are key elements of the 21st Century economy of the North Cascades.   As a member of the North Central Washington Economic Development District  and the North Central Washington Resource, Conservation and Development boards we work in many ways to promote the marriage of conservation values and economic development of gateway communities.
